比特幣交易所 比特幣交易所
Ctrl+D 比特幣交易所
ads

DAG系統區塊大小和出塊時間的通俗解析之一-ODAILY_POW

Author:

Time:1900/1/1 0:00:00

大家好,今天來講講區塊大小和出塊時間這個問題,順便聊一下在SoteriaDAG的設計里,我們是怎么處理這個問題的。

擴容是問題的關鍵

區塊大小和出塊時間是一對設計變量,直接決定了區塊鏈系統的容量。拿比特幣系統來舉例:

比特幣系統大致每10分鐘挖出一個1MB的區塊。而每筆交易平均占250字節。所以一個區塊可以容納4000筆交易。10分鐘里有4000筆交易,于是就有了每秒7筆交易這個系統容量的著名數字。如果要擴容一千倍,我們可以把這兩個參數調整一下嗎?比如區塊大小變成100MB,出塊時間變成每秒一個,于是就有了新的系統容量數字:400000/60~每秒7000筆交易,秒殺paypal和visa。答案顯然是NO。而且問題不在存儲,而是在于網絡傳輸。

庫幣將啟動DAG主網升級換幣:據庫幣KuCoin消息,庫幣將于28日啟動Constellation (DAG)主網升級換幣工作。屆時,庫幣會將用戶的DAG數字資產完成主網幣的自動切換。庫幣是一家全球性數字貨幣交易所,為來自207個國家的500萬用戶提供幣幣、法幣、合約、礦池、借貸等一站式服務。[2020/4/27]

網絡傳輸與安全基礎

POW的安全的基礎,是建立在個人算力不超過全網算力的50%這一基礎上的。而潛在的必要條件是任何節點要和網絡其他節點公平競爭。這就跟賽跑一樣,大家得一起起跑才行。而區塊鏈系統是個異步系統,POW的安全性只有系統狀態就近同步的情況下才能保證。POW挖礦獎勵其實有一個重要原則就是獎勵礦工們盡快的把自己挖出來的區塊廣播出去,被網絡接收;同時在使勁的接收從網絡傳回來的其他區塊,而不是把算力浪費在成不了氣候的鏈上(最長鏈原則)。這進進出出(TX/RX)其實本質是利用礦工在系統框架下的自然行為保證了網絡的同步。

行情 | 概念板塊集中反彈 基于DAG概念漲幅居首:根據非小號數據顯示,目前各概念板塊集中反彈,22個概念板塊中僅支付概念下跌。目前排名第一的板塊是基于DAG,平均漲幅為10.67%,其中NANO在板塊中漲幅第一,漲幅為43.22%;排名第二的板塊是數據存儲,平均漲幅為10.65%,其中DDD在板塊中漲幅第一,漲幅為49.33%;排名第三的板塊是2018世界杯,平均漲幅為8.85%,其中SOC在板塊中漲幅第一,漲幅為51.25%。排名倒數前三的板塊分別是支付概念,IFO概念,比特幣山寨;板塊平均漲幅分別是-0.03%,0.74%,1.63%。[2018/8/17]

從發卷考試到挖礦

大家小時候上學的時候都是經常考試吧。那個時候老師會把卷子給第一排的童鞋,然后一個一個的從前往后傳。坐在最后一排的童鞋總是非常晚地拿到卷子。那么好了,如果拿到卷子的童鞋就開始做了,那最后一排的同學拿到卷子的時候,第一排的同學都開始做好久了,搞不好還做完了,這個不公平。所以,老師要求每個同學拿到卷子的時候扣在課桌上,等到大家都拿到了,老師說“現在開始記時”,大家才能開始做。這就是公平競爭帶來的同步。

PoS/DPoS+DAG或者BFT+DAG更有可能成為未來DAG項目的共識機制:Node Capital研究中心在闡述DAG 項目的投資邏輯時表示,目前已經落地的DAG公鏈項目都不具備智能合約的功能,因此目前新募集的DAG項目都會以具備圖靈完備智能合約平臺,或者提供智能合約跨鏈執行的接口作為賣點。由于目前DAG共識機制的學術研究尚處于進展過程中,這些號稱能實現智能合約的DAG項目是否能在近期實現所宣稱的功能,仍要打上一個問號。由于DAG高并發、異步的特征,非常適合IoT類應用,許多IoT類項目都會偏愛DAG架構。IOTA就是以處理機器間小額高頻交易為應用場景。另一方面,IoT設備一般不具備PoW挖礦所需的算力,因此PoS/DPoS+DAG或者BFT+DAG更有可能成為未來DAG項目的共識機制。[2018/6/11]

fex發布關于XDAG通過第三方平臺充值的通知:fex發布公告稱,XDAG幣種充值需要人工入賬,近段時間出現大量用戶通過第三方平臺充值XDAG,因少于8位小數或小數位錯誤導致FEX平臺無法核準入賬,XDAG原路返回第三方平臺也會無法入賬。FEX平臺為提升用戶體驗,減少用戶損失,需通過第三方平臺充值的用戶(未到賬)聯系官方客服進行視頻認證,并在24小時后由人工審核后入賬。[2018/5/18]

這里邊有兩個變量:第一個是傳卷子的時間,第二個是做題目的時間。卷子可以是一張紙,也可以厚厚一沓。假設我們傳卷子必須要一張一張的傳,因為老師印卷子的時候是每一頁都印了全班的量。所以,傳卷子可以半分鐘就傳完了,也可以傳10分鐘都沒有全發完。同樣,題目也難可易,聰明的童鞋用計算器可以十分鐘就做完了,嚴謹的童鞋完全口算,也許要兩個小時才做完。

TrustNote項目代表李萌昊:高速異步DAG數據結構和雙層共識機制可以突破鏈式結構的瓶頸:近日,在首屆VE區塊鏈創投(北京)交流會上TrustNote項目代表李萌昊作了主題分享。他表示,高速異步DAG數據結構和雙層共識機制可以突破鏈式結構的瓶頸,可以極大地提升P2P網絡價值。[2018/5/7]

你現在估計明白我為什么說發卷考試了。傳卷子就對應我們的區塊大小,題目的難度就對應我們的出塊時間。小小的區別在于:在區塊系統里,沒有老師給大家喊“現在開始記時”;而是,童鞋們拿到考卷就開始做。具體是這樣一個節奏:每一個新產生的區塊,網絡傳播的時間是半分鐘。每個礦工都是收到這個新塊驗證無誤了之后才開始在上邊挖礦。新區塊就像一份新的試卷,網絡傳播就是發卷。而這個卷子發給所有同學需要至少半分鐘,然鵝,每輪挖礦總有人比別的人早半分鐘拿到試卷。但是礦工覺得這其實也無所謂,首先,題挺難的,考試時間是十分鐘,晚拿到試卷半分鐘影響不太大;其次,和在教室里考試不一樣,大家的座次是隨機的而且經常在換,先拿到考卷的人每次都不一樣,所以也沒問題。有些倒霉的礦工在TA挖出一個新塊的時候半分鐘在網絡另外一邊已經產生出來的新塊還沒有傳播到他這里。于是他的新塊就被無情的drop了,也就是變成了孤塊。TA的工作就也被無情的浪費了。不過這個沒辦法,設計就是贏者通吃,但是TA在客觀上其實對整個網絡的安全也做了貢獻

擴容之殤

我們想要擴容,能做的是要么把區塊的尺寸變大,要么縮短出塊時間,要么兩個都變。我們先試試出塊速度從10分鐘改成半分鐘。這下亂了,考卷還沒有發完有些童鞋就做完開始拿下一套考卷做了。于是教室里的混亂場面一度無法控制:滿地的做了一半的考卷,大家都在忙著收新來的考卷。這個參數的調整導致出現大量的孤塊和分叉,不僅大量的網絡算力被浪費了,而且更關鍵的是我們前邊說的同步帶來的安全模型也蕩然無存了:每一套新的試卷,都沒發給全班呢,就有一小簇童鞋做出來了。于是重新發下一套試卷。也就是說平均每個童鞋就只做了15秒的題,就得要么完成要么白做了。這個直接帶來的結果就是只有一半的算力在做有用工作,另外一半在做錯誤的考卷。從網絡攻擊者的角度上看,如下圖所示,TA其實只是在和一半的算力在拼,也就是說只要他的算力占全網絡的33%,TA就有可能贏,而不是我們平時所說的50%

那我們再試試把區塊大小增加到之前的二十倍,也就是也變成10分鐘。同樣的道理,每套卷子的頁數多了,發卷子的時間變長了,也就是傳輸的時間變長了,而做卷子的時間不變,也就是出塊的速度不變,那最后教室里還是同樣的混亂:仍然出現大量的孤塊和分叉,以及造成了相似的算力浪費。于是我們可以看出來,只要傳輸速度和出塊速度可比,系統一開始設計的很多特性都無法保證了,特別是安全性。這兩個參數不可比的時候就可以了嗎?比如把區塊大小增加4倍,離20倍還挺遠,可以嗎?然,也是不太行的。因為區塊的大小變了,等于我在兩套協議下工作,我更改的那一刻之前就有一大堆部署兼容等等的各種軟件工程和社區的問題需要考慮和處理。這個是個非常荊棘的道路,我們找個機會在《StoteriaDAG和分叉的通俗解析》中仔細的科普。不管如何,大家現在應該明白了擴容這件事其實是這兩個參數互相制約,互相作用之下的妥協結果。這個問題在DAG的環境下就更加有趣了。

包容之美

我們做BlockDAG,其中一個重要的目標其實就是擴容。我們前邊討論已經顯見:擴容被一對互斥的參數制約。他們之所以在blockchain系統里表現的這么復雜,說到底還是網絡同步和贏者通吃這兩條原則導致的。試想,如果后排的童鞋收到卷子的時候,即使前排童鞋都做完了,已經要下一套試卷了,他們仍然堅持做完并且得到心儀的分數,這樣沒有喇嘛多的孤塊兒和分叉,這將多么美好啊。BlockDAG就是解決了這個問題,礦工們可以并行的挖礦,不用擔心別人挖出來新的區塊之后,自己這個新塊就沒用了;而是全心全意的繼續挖礦,并及時的把挖出來的區塊廣播出去。下一篇連載我們會詳細討論在DAG的前提下,這兩個參數是如何互動的。

Tags:DAGFEXXDAGPOWAndaGoldSafeXIxdag幣價格今日行情Powabit

芝麻開門交易所
彭博社:60家主要加密公司中許多公司沒有第三方審計師和獨立董事會_COL

彭博社在第一季度調查了60家主要的加密公司,涵蓋交易所、礦業公司、分析公司和代幣發行商,以評估該行業的治理和控制狀況。其中許多公司,包括幣安、Coinbase、Tether和OpenSea等.

1900/1/1 0:00:00
全球政策 | 美國加州計劃利用“微型債券”ICO拯救經濟適用房-ODAILY_穩定幣

由于特朗普稅改導致的聯邦政府資金削減,加州、紐約州、新澤西州等高收入地區的購房成本猛漲。不僅如此,眾多公共設施的預算也遭削減。為了應對這樣的困境,加州伯克利市正打算利用加密令牌籌集資金.

1900/1/1 0:00:00
專注于開源藥物發現的去中心化自治組織LabDAO完成360萬美元融資_NFT

據CoinDesk報道,專注于開源藥物發現的去中心化自治組織LabDAO完成360萬美元融資,Inflection.xyz和VillageGlobal共同領投.

1900/1/1 0:00:00
2019年犯罪分子把「比特幣」發送到哪里了?-ODAILY_SIS

編者按:本文來自碳鏈價值,編譯:白天,Odaily星球日報經授權轉載。對于犯罪分子們來說,一旦獲得大量非法所得的加密貨幣,他們都會面臨一個問題:如何在不被捕情況下把錢包里加密貨幣轉換成合法現金?.

1900/1/1 0:00:00
1月10日比特幣行情分析全天解析:市場收縮有待穩固-ODAILY_ECA

今日資訊 1、澳大利亞儲備銀行表示一直關注加密貨幣發展發,并認為目前仍不清楚國內是否會有強勁的需求.

1900/1/1 0:00:00
去中心化預言機如何幫助智能合約獲取外部數據-ODAILY_INK

智能合約本身沒有訪問區塊鏈外部數據的能力。而外部的數據對于大多數智能合約應用場景來說都是至關重要的,所以這一功能的缺失限制了智能合約的更進一步的發展.

1900/1/1 0:00:00
ads